比特币密钥有多长?格式及安全性详解

sun

加密基础知识

比特币密钥是确保交易安全和保护用户资产的重要组成部分。了解比特币密钥的长度、格式以及它的安全性,对于每一个参与加密货币交易的用户来说至关重要。本文将详细解释比特币密钥的结构、其生成方式及如何确保其安全性,同时提供一些实用的安全建议,帮助你有效避免潜在的风险。

pic 761

比特币密钥的长度及格式

在比特币的世界里,密钥是数字资产管理和交易的核心。比特币的密钥分为公钥和私钥,每个密钥有其独特的格式和长度,理解这些差异有助于确保你的比特币交易安全。

比特币公钥和私钥的长度

比特币的公钥和私钥分别对应着比特币地址的公开和私密部分。它们的长度分别为:

  • 公钥:比特币的公钥通常为65字节,即由130个字符组成,采用椭圆曲线加密算法(EC)生成。公钥是公开的,任何人都可以使用它来验证比特币的交易。
  • 私钥:比特币私钥通常为32字节,由64个字符组成。这是一个随机生成的数字,它是与公钥配对的唯一身份标识,用来签署和验证比特币交易。私钥必须严格保密,一旦泄露,其他人便能控制你的比特币。

比特币密钥的格式

比特币密钥采用特定的编码格式,其中最常见的是WIF(Wallet Import Format)和Hex(十六进制)格式。这两种格式常用于表示私钥和公钥。

  • WIF格式:WIF是私钥的简化格式,使用Base58编码,通常以“5”开头。它使得私钥更加简洁并方便用户手动输入。WIF格式通常用于比特币钱包中私钥的导入和导出。
  • Hex格式:Hex格式表示私钥或公钥时,采用十六进制字符。这种格式较为原始,便于程序识别和处理。

比特币密钥的安全性

比特币的安全性在很大程度上依赖于私钥的保护。私钥一旦丢失或泄露,任何人都可以获取对应的比特币。因此,了解如何有效保护比特币密钥是每个比特币用户的首要任务。

私钥的保护方法

  • 离线存储:将私钥存储在离线设备上,比如硬件钱包或纸钱包。这些设备与互联网断开连接,降低了黑客入侵的风险。
  • 加密存储:在存储私钥时,可以采用加密方法进一步增强安全性。例如,将私钥存储在加密的USB设备中,只有通过密码才能解密。
  • 多重签名:使用多重签名钱包,可以要求多个密钥来授权一笔交易。这不仅提升了交易的安全性,也降低了单个密钥泄露的风险。

私钥丢失后的解决方案

比特币网络没有传统的银行服务系统,也没有密钥恢复的机制,因此一旦私钥丢失,就无法恢复比特币。为了避免这种情况,建议:

  • 备份私钥:定期将私钥或助记词(恢复种子)备份,并保存在多个安全位置,如防火墙保护的硬盘或加密云存储中。
  • 使用助记词:助记词是一种通过一组易记单词(通常为12或24个)来帮助恢复私钥的方式。通过助记词可以有效降低丢失私钥后的风险。

常见的比特币密钥攻击方式

尽管比特币使用了强大的加密技术,但仍然存在一些常见的攻击方式,用户需要警惕。

  • 网络钓鱼攻击:黑客通过伪装成正规交易平台或钱包应用来诱导用户输入私钥。用户应确保只在官方平台上输入自己的密钥信息。
  • 恶意软件攻击:一些恶意软件会窃取用户电脑中的私钥信息,特别是一些没有安全防护的电脑。定期更新操作系统和使用可靠的防病毒软件能够有效预防这类攻击。

比特币密钥安全性的未来发展

随着加密技术的不断进步,比特币密钥的安全性也在不断提升。区块链技术的应用,尤其是在隐私保护和密钥管理方面,可能为比特币的安全性带来新的突破。

新型加密技术的应用

随着量子计算技术的发展,传统的加密方式可能面临挑战。为应对这一潜在威胁,科研人员正在研究基于量子抗性算法的加密技术。未来,比特币密钥的生成和保护可能会借助更加复杂和高效的加密技术来提升安全性。

去中心化身份验证

去中心化身份验证技术(DID)有望改变比特币密钥管理的方式。通过将身份验证与区块链技术相结合,用户的私钥和身份信息将得到更高水平的保护。这也能进一步提升比特币网络的隐私性和安全性。

总结

比特币密钥的长度、格式和安全性直接关系到你的比特币资产的安全。理解并正确管理私钥、采取有效的安全措施,是每个比特币用户的基本责任。在不断变化的加密世界中,保持警惕并采取多重保护措施,将大大降低资产丢失的风险,确保你的比特币交易更加安全。